Adrian Durham tore into Arsenal supporters who booed manager Unai Emery during the New Year’s Day victory over Fulham.The Gunners secured a comfortable 4-1 over their London neighbours at the Emirates, but the scoreline was generous for the hosts.Durham mocked Arsenal fans who questioned Emery’s tactics2

Ryan Sessegnon had a host of chances for the visitors and, with the scores at 2-1, there was a real chance of an upset.However, the introduction of Aaron Ramsey for Alexandre Lacazette changed the game as the contract rebel came on to score.The substitution, however, had been met with disdain by some of the the home supporters, who were perhaps hoping to see the Spaniard continue to try to attack their lowly rivals.And while even the most vociferous Arsenal fan is likely to have forgiven Emery after the substitution paid off, Drivetime host Adrian Durham was angered by the petulance of the home supporters.Emery brought on Ramsey, who had an instant impact2

I just want to know who on earth the fans think they are, he said on Wednesday.Its almost like the fans have taken over at Arsenal. They mobilised themselves to get Wenger out with all the protests and now, theyre booing an Unai Emery substitution when theyre 2-1 up.And, by the way, what happened within eight minutes of Aaron Ramsey coming on? He scored and they got another one as well, they scored and they won 4-1. So the substitution was correct!Durham then mocked fans who questioned the validity of the substitution. He added: Oh no you cant take Ramsey off, oh no you cant bring Ramsey off, oh no you cant make that substitution What do you know?What exactly do you lot know that Unai Emery doesnt? What is it that you know about those players that he doesnt know?Please tell me, Im furious with Arsenal fans about this! Why dont they give the fellow a flipping chance?

Kasper Peter Schmeichel (Danish pronunciation: [kʰæspɐ ˈsmaɪ̯ˀkl̩]; born 5 November 1986) is a Danish professional footballer who plays as a goalkeeper for Premier League club Leicester City and the Denmark national team. He is the son of former Manchester United and Danish international goalkeeper Peter Schmeichel.
